An account of the wartime performance of the De Havilland Mosquito, a British twin-engine shoulder-winged multi-role combat aircraft, introduced during the Second World War. Unusual in that its frame is constructed mostly of wood. 'David & Charles Aircraft Family Monographs', seies. 128 pages : illustrations ; 26 cm.
